scDLC
scDLC classifies large-scale single-cell RNA sequencing (scRNA-seq) data using long short-term memory (LSTM) recurrent neural networks to identify cell types and patterns in gene expression.
Key Features:
- Deep Learning Framework: Core built on long short-term memory (LSTM) recurrent neural networks that capture long-term dependencies and complex relationships among genes in scRNA-seq datasets.
- Scale Invariance: Operates as a scale-invariant method and does not require preprocessing steps for data scaling or normalization.
- Independence from Data Distribution Assumptions: Does not rely on specific distributional assumptions such as Poisson, negative binomial, or zero-inflated Poisson used by PLDA, NBLDA, and ZIPLDA.
- Focus on Feature Gene Dependencies: Emphasizes modeling dependencies among the most significant feature genes within the LSTM architecture.
- Performance Evaluation: Shown by simulation studies and analyses of real-world datasets to consistently outperform existing methods across large sample settings.
Scientific Applications:
- Disease Diagnosis and Medical Research: Classifies cells in scRNA-seq datasets to support disease diagnosis and related medical research.
- Cellular Heterogeneity Analysis: Resolves and characterizes cellular heterogeneity by classifying cells based on gene expression profiles.
- High-Throughput scRNA-seq Studies: Applies to large-scale, high-throughput scRNA-seq datasets for cell-type identification and pattern discovery.
Methodology:
Training long short-term memory (LSTM) recurrent neural networks on scRNA-seq gene expression matrices without prior distributional assumptions or normalization, modeling dependencies among selected feature genes.
